    CP3UB26G18NEPX/NOPB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

    • Texas Instruments provides a recommended PCB layout for the CP3UB26G18NEPX/NOPB in the datasheet, but it's also recommended to follow general guidelines for thermal management, such as using a solid ground plane, placing thermal vias under the device, and using a heat sink if necessary.
    • To ensure reliable operation in high-temperature environments, it's essential to follow the recommended operating conditions, use a heat sink if necessary, and ensure good thermal conductivity between the device and the PCB. Additionally, consider using a thermally-enhanced package or a device with a higher temperature rating if possible.
    • Using a different voltage regulator or power supply may affect the performance and reliability of the CP3UB26G18NEPX/NOPB. Ensure that the voltage regulator or power supply meets the recommended voltage and current requirements, and consider the output noise and ripple voltage when selecting an alternative.
    • To troubleshoot issues with the CP3UB26G18NEPX/NOPB, start by reviewing the datasheet and application notes, and then use debugging tools such as oscilloscopes or logic analyzers to identify the root cause of the issue. Consider consulting with Texas Instruments' technical support or seeking guidance from experienced engineers.
    • When using the CP3UB26G18NEPX/NOPB in a radiation-hardened or high-reliability application, consider the device's radiation tolerance, single-event effects (SEEs), and total ionizing dose (TID) ratings. Ensure that the device meets the required standards and regulations, and consult with Texas Instruments' technical support or radiation effects experts.
